I finalised January's figures during my lunch break and although they weren't as good as I'd have liked, they weren't terrible either.
I overspent by £34.08 in total for the month, and £21 of that was a birthday present and card for DH3. The other massive overspend was diesel - a whopping £67 compared to my budget of £30. I hadn't realised we use quite so much as DH used to put some in the tank too.
The one good thing was that my grocery budget was set at £75 and I only spent £62.58 as we were very well stocked before the start of the year.
